Abdullah bin Abbas reported,

The Prophet ﷺ went out on the day of Eid and prayed two rakahs, neither praying before them nor after. Then he turned toward the women, with Bilal accompanying him, and admonished them and ordered them to give in charity. So a woman would toss in her bracelet and her earring.

Bukhari 1431

Sahih
